Original Description
The Water Carrier by Béla Iványi Grünwald is a captivating masterpiece of Hungarian Post-Impressionism, painted in the early 20th century. With its warm, earthy palette and soft yet dynamic brushstrokes, the painting exudes a quiet, nostalgic charm, portraying a humble water carrier immersed in his daily task. Grünwald, a prominent figure in the Nagybánya artists' colony, masterfully blends naturalism with decorative stylization, infusing the scene with both dignity and motion. The play of light and shadow, along with the rhythmic composition, draws viewers into the harmonious simplicity of rural life. Historically significant, the work reflects the artist's commitment to elevating folk subjects through modern techniques, bridging traditional Hungarian themes with European avant-garde influences. It remains a celebrated example of how regional art movements contributed to the broader tapestry of art history.
